    *Public Testimony will be called for each agenda item and must be limited to matters listed on the meeting agenda. 

    Hawai‘i Revised Statutes, Chapter 92, Public Agency Meetings and Records, prohibits Board members from discussing or taking action on matters not listed on the meeting agenda.

    In accordance with Section 1 of Chapter III entitled “Organization of the Board and Committees Board Elections and Certification Process” of the OHA BOT Operations Manual (July 2007): “The Administrator sets the date for the first Board meeting, no later than two months after the election and notifies the Trustees.” In accordance with Section 1 of Chapter III entitled “Organization of the Board and Committees – Board Elections and Certification Process” of the OHA BOT Operations Manual (July 2007): “The most senior Trustee (longest serving) shall act as the Temporary Chair until the election of the Chair and Vice Chair.”
